Recommendation for Management of Energy Efficient Operation in Town… At Household Level Energy Responsive Buildings most of the metropolitan area is covered with lots of residential developments. building sector accounts for the major energy share of energy consumption  From the literature of traditional settlement pattern of KTM and case study of Cape Town  include optimization overall layout, orientation of building and integration of passive techniques.  use light and fresh air efficiently in order to reduce energy demands for heating, cooling, lighting and ventilation.  The building envelope (wall, floor, roof and fenestration) need to integrate with building service functions such as heating, cooling, natural ventilation, sufficient daylighting and energy storage. Recommendation for Management of Energy Efficient Operation in Town… At Household Level Rain Water Harvesting and Recharging Aquifer…  If a household have water extraction/ storage well then it should also have recharge well.  Recharge of well/ aquifer - by discharge of rainwater & waste water from bathroom sinks, bath tub shower drains, and clothes washing equipment drains.  integrate the pervious surfaces on lawn, parking lot and walkways  Also part of improving urban planning and enhancing renewable source of energy Energy Efficiency of Planning in Towns of KMC

Recommendation for Management of Energy Efficient Operation in Town… At Policy Level Encourage use of Public Transportation System  encourage smart public transportation system Providing monthly bus cards, semester cards, employed cards, student cards etc in discount cost  Management of transportation system planning of integrated route networks, provision of mass transit, punctual service, safety and security as well as good manner of drive and conductor.  Bus stops should linked up with the non motorized transport system  operating public transportation even at late night hours  start again the trolly bus system and integrate with all the smart systems Energy Efficiency of Planning in Towns of KMC

Recommendation for Management of Energy Efficient Operation in Town… At Policy Level Other Policies       Encourage smart solar street lighting system and traffic lighting Incentives on CFL and LED lights Higher the price of other energy intensive lights or increase tax to such lights Incentives on electric vehicles and provide attractive tax free schemes Penalize the tall buildings for casting shadows on neighboring building Homogenize the price of products, education fees and other service charges so that it encourage people to use services that are available at proximate.
